### **Pros and Cons of Buying a BMW PSA69804 (2012 2016 F30 330i/328i RWD Front Right Steering Passenger Tie Rod Link)**
#### **Pros:**1. **Common and Widely Available** The PSA69804 tie rod link is a standard part for the F30 330i/328i, meaning it is easy to find at BMW dealerships, aftermarket suppliers, and online marketplaces. This reduces the risk of long wait times or difficulty sourcing replacements.
2. **Affordable Replacement Cost** Compared to other suspension components, tie rod links are relatively inexpensive, typically ranging from $50 to $150 depending on whether you opt for OEM, Genuine BMW, or aftermarket brands. Labor costs are also reasonable since it s a straightforward bolt-on replacement.
3. **Simple Installation** Replacing a tie rod link is a moderately easy DIY job for those with basic mechanical skills. It requires removing the wheel, disconnecting the tie rod from the steering rack and knuckle, and installing the new one. No major modifications or specialized tools are needed beyond a socket set and a torque wrench.
4. **Prevents Further Damage** A worn tie rod link can lead to misaligned wheels, uneven tire wear, or even steering issues. Replacing it early prevents more costly problems like bent steering racks, worn bushings, or suspension damage.
5. **Improves Driving Comfort and Safety** A functioning tie rod ensures proper wheel alignment, which enhances handling, reduces vibration, and improves tire longevity. It also contributes to safer steering response, especially at higher speeds.
6. **Long-Term Reliability** BMW s F30 models are known for their durability, and suspension components like tie rod links are designed to last tens of thousands of miles if maintained properly. Replacing a worn one extends the life of the entire steering and suspension system.
7. **Aftermarket Options Available** If you re on a budget, aftermarket brands (e.g., Febi Bilstein, Dorman, or local manufacturers) offer high-quality alternatives to OEM parts at a lower cost without sacrificing performance or durability.

#### **Cons:**1. **Wear and Tear Over Time** Like all suspension components, tie rod links degrade due to constant stress, road debris, and wear. If not inspected regularly, they can fail unexpectedly, leading to sudden steering issues or loss of control in extreme cases.
2. **Potential for Rust or Corrosion** In regions with harsh winters or salted roads, tie rod links (especially those made of steel) can corrode over time. Rust weakens the component, increasing the risk of failure. Aluminum or coated parts may be more resistant but can still degrade if not properly maintained.
3. **Misalignment Risks** If the tie rod link is not installed correctly or if the wheel alignment is not reset after replacement, it can lead to uneven tire wear, poor handling, or even damage to other suspension parts (e.g., ball joints, control arms).
4. **DIY Difficulty for Beginners** While the job is manageable for experienced DIYers, those without mechanical experience may struggle with tasks like removing the wheel, disconnecting the tie rod from the steering rack, or ensuring proper torque specifications. Improper installation can void warranties or cause premature failure.
5. **Hidden Damage** A tie rod link that appears visually intact may still be internally worn or cracked. Without a thorough inspection (or replacing both links if one is bad), you risk repeating the issue soon after replacement.
6. **Compatibility Concerns** While the PSA69804 fits the F30 330i/328i, ensure it matches your exact model year and configuration (e.g., RWD vs. xDrive). Mixing up parts can lead to improper fitment or functionality.
7. **Labor Costs if Professional Installation is Chosen** If you opt for a dealership or mechanic to replace the tie rod link, labor costs (typically $100 $200 per hour) can add up, especially if additional work (e.g., alignment) is required.

### **Recommendation:**1. **Inspect Regularly** Check the tie rod link for play, rust, or damage during routine tire rotations or suspension inspections. If you notice uneven tire wear, a clunking noise, or a loose feeling in the steering, have it inspected immediately.
2. **Replace Both Links if One is Bad** Tie rod links wear in pairs, so replacing just one may lead to future issues. If one is compromised, the other is likely close behind.
3. **Choose Quality Parts** Opt for **OEM (Genuine BMW) or reputable aftermarket brands** (e.g., Febi Bilstein, ACDelco, or local high-quality suppliers) to ensure durability. Avoid overly cheap parts that may fail prematurely.
4. **DIY or Professional Installation?**
- If you re comfortable with basic mechanical work, **DIY installation** is feasible and cost-effective.
- If unsure, **hire a professional** to ensure proper installation and alignment, especially if you re not experienced with suspension work.
5. **Reset Wheel Alignment** After replacement, **always get a wheel alignment** to prevent uneven tire wear and ensure optimal handling.
6. **Consider Protective Measures** If you drive in harsh conditions (salt, mud, off-road), consider **coated or aluminum tie rod links** to reduce rust risk.
